Output 953020cf0081848e108dd796bad12b60f558d1a51ac461c57d99af10bc42143b:0
- value
- 2500000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f376aa54b39a6a350ca324a5bc778e106ef8e0 OP_EQUAL
- address
- 3BMEXq36jE5JcQdbkuZA6bduV352wzPg58
- transaction
- 953020cf0081848e108dd796bad12b60f558d1a51ac461c57d99af10bc42143b
- confirmations
- 357744
- spent
- true